Caretta‐Weyer HA, Park YS, Tekian A, Sebok‐Syer SS. Identifying emergency medicine program directors' expectations of competence upon entry into residency: Bridging the distance from the Association of American Medical Colleges Core Entrustable Professional Activities. AEM EDUCATION AND TRAINING 2025; 9:e70024. [PMID: 40083335 PMCID: PMC11897532 DOI: 10.1002/aet2.70024]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Received: 12/01/2024] [Revised: 02/02/2025] [Accepted: 02/18/2025] [Indexed: 03/16/2025]
Abstract
Background Residency program directors (PDs) frequently describe students as unprepared for the patient care responsibilities expected of them upon entry into residency. The Association of American Medical Colleges (AAMC) developed the Core Entrustable Professional Activities (Core EPAs) to address this concern by defining 13 tasks students should be able to do with minimal supervision upon graduation. However, the Core EPAs remain difficult for PDs to use due to their breadth and lack of granularity. Methods Using Delphi consensus methodology, we identified granular observable practice activities (OPAs) that PDs expect of entering interns derived from the Core EPAs. Twelve emergency medicine education experts drafted OPAs based on the Core EPAs and their associated core functions described in one-page schematics. A separate group of 12 PDs underwent three rounds of voting, and consensus for inclusion was set at 70%. Thematic analysis of comments discussing votes was performed using an inductive approach. Results A total of 321 OPAs were drafted and 127 adopted as expectations for entering interns based on the Core EPAs. The adopted OPAs were all general expectations; none were specialty-specific. Four main themes were identified from the comments: Schools are not responsible for specialty-specific training, PDs do not fully trust schools' assessments, supervision expectations of graduates should be lowered for higher-order EPAs, and the context in which the student performs a task and its associated complexity matter greatly in entrustment decisions. Conclusions PDs agree with the generalist focus of the AAMC Core EPAs and feel strongly that specialty training should be left to residency programs. They also have mechanisms in place to verify entrustment within their local context. Transparency in assessment and summative entrustment processes in UME may unify expectations. Finally, the granularity of OPAs may aid in a post-Match handover to further operationalize the EPAs and optimize the UME-to-GME transition.

Cabrera JP, Gary MF, Muthu S, Yoon ST, Kim HJ, Cho SK, Ćorluka S, Lewis SJ, Kato S, Buser Z, Wang JC, Hsieh PC. Surgeon Preferences Worldwide in Wound Drain Utilization in Open Lumbar Fusion Surgery for Degenerative Pathologies. Global Spine J 2025; 15:749-758. [PMID: 37897691 PMCID: PMC11877467 DOI: 10.1177/21925682231210184]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 10/30/2023] Open
Abstract
STUDY DESIGN Cross-sectional survey. OBJECTIVE Although literature does not recommend routine wound drain utilization, there is a disconnect between the evidence and clinical practice. This study aims to explore into this controversy and analyze the surgeon preferences related to drain utilization, and the factors influencing drain use and criterion for removal. METHODS A survey was distributed to AO Spine members worldwide. Surgeon demographics and factors related to peri-operative drain use in 1 or 2-level open fusion surgery for lumbar degenerative pathologies were collected. Multivariate analyses by drain utilization, and criterion of removal were conducted. RESULTS 231 surgeons participated, including 220 males (95.2%), orthopedics (178, 77.1%), and academic/university-affiliated (114, 49.4%). Most surgeons preferred drain use (186, 80.5%) and subfascial drains (169, 73.2%). Drains were removed based on duration by 52.87% of the surgeons, but 27.7% removed drains based on outputs. On multivariable analysis, significant predictors of drain use were surgeon's aged 35-44 (OR = 11.9, 95% CI = 1.2-117.2, P = .034), 45-54 (29.1, 3.1-269.6, P = .003), 55-64 (8.9, 1.4-56.5, .019), and wound closure using coaptive films (6.0, 1.2-29.0, P = .025). Additionally, surgeons from Asia Pacific (OR = 5.19, 95% CI = 1.65-16.38, P = .005), Europe (3.55, 1.22-10.31, P = .020), and Latin America (4.40, 1.09-17.83, .038) were more likely to remove drain based on time duration, but surgeons <5 years of experience (10.23, 1.75-59.71, P = .010) were more likely to remove drains based on outputs. CONCLUSIONS Most spine surgeons worldwide prefer to place a subfascial wound drain for degenerative open lumbar surgery. The choice for drain placement is associated with the surgeon's age and use of coaptive films for wound closure, while the criterion for drain removal is associated with the surgeons' region of practice and experience.

Chiel LE, Fishman M, Driessen E, Winn AS. Novice Experts: Exploring Fellows' Perspectives on the Transition from Residency to Fellowship. PERSPECTIVES ON MEDICAL EDUCATION 2025; 14:66-73. [PMID: 39957723 PMCID: PMC11827558 DOI: 10.5334/pme.1654]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 01/02/2025] [Accepted: 01/23/2025] [Indexed: 02/18/2025]
Abstract
Introduction Advanced training experiences are required in certain countries for subspecialization. In the United States, a decline in Milestones and in levels of supervision for Entrustable Professional Activities for incoming subspecialty fellows has been described and attributed to changes in context that fellows experience. We aimed to explore this transition to advanced training, and specifically to describe which contextual factors are salient to fellows at the residency to fellowship transition and the supports available for a smooth transition to fellowship. Methods Using contextual competence as a sensitizing concept, ten semi-structured interviews with first- and second-year pediatric subspecialty fellows from three subspecialties were performed at a large academic medical center in 2023, using thematic analysis informed by elements of constructivist grounded theory. Results Contextual factors that impacted the transition included changes in systems, necessary knowledge, and roles and responsibilities. At times, participants describe a tension between feeling like novices while simultaneously feeling like they should have more expertise than they had. Supports in navigating this tension, and in navigating the transition more generally, included formal orientations, fellow behaviors and perspective, and input from others. Conclusions The transition to advanced training is characterized, at times, by experiencing tension between feeling like a novice while feeling like one should have expertise, with fellows' own behaviors and the support of those around them being essential to fellows' smooth transition. While fellowship programs offer orientations, systems-level solutions for supporting fellows' navigation of the transition are underexplored.

Ovitsh RK, Gupta S, Kusnoor A, Jackson JM, Roussel D, Mooney CJ, Pinto-Powell R, Appel JL, Mhaskar R, Gold J. Minding the gap: towards a shared clinical reasoning lexicon across the pre-clerkship/clerkship transition. MEDICAL EDUCATION ONLINE 2024; 29:2307715. [PMID: 38320116 PMCID: PMC10848998 DOI: 10.1080/10872981.2024.2307715]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 08/24/2023] [Accepted: 01/16/2024] [Indexed: 02/08/2024]
Abstract
Teaching and learning of clinical reasoning are core principles of medical education. However, little guidance exists for faculty leaders to navigate curricular transitions between pre-clerkship and clerkship curricular phases. This study compares how educational leaders in these two phases understand clinical reasoning instruction. Previously reported cross-sectional surveys of pre-clerkship clinical skills course directors, and clerkship leaders were compared. Comparisons focused on perceived importance of a number of core clinical reasoning concepts, barriers to clinical reasoning instruction, level of familiarity across the undergraduate medical curriculum, and inclusion of clinical reasoning instruction in each area of the curriculum. Analyses were performed using the Mann Whitney U test. Both sets of leaders rated lack of curricular time as the largest barrier to teaching clinical reasoning. Clerkship leaders also noted a lack of faculty with skills to teach clinical reasoning concepts as a significant barrier (p < 0.02), while pre-clerkship leaders were more likely to perceive that these concepts were too advanced for their students (p < 0.001). Pre-clerkship leaders reported a higher level of familiarity with the clerkship curriculum than clerkship leaders reported of the pre-clerkship curriculum (p < 0.001). As faculty transition students from the pre-clerkship to the clerkship phase, a shared understanding of what is taught and when, accompanied by successful faculty development, may aid the development of longitudinal, milestone-based clinical reasoning instruction.

Heidemann LA, Kempner S, Kobernik E, Jones E, Peterson WJ, Allen BB, Wixson M, Morgan HK. Improving medical students' responses to emergencies with a simulated cross-cover paging curriculum. MEDICAL EDUCATION ONLINE 2024; 29:2430576. [PMID: 39600155 DOI: 10.1080/10872981.2024.2430576]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 03/07/2024] [Revised: 10/21/2024] [Accepted: 11/13/2024] [Indexed: 11/29/2024]
Abstract
New residents are often unprepared to respond to medical emergencies. To address this gap, we implemented a simulated cross-cover paging curriculum. All senior medical students enrolled in a required specialty-specific (internal medicine, procedures, emergency medicine [EM], obstetrics and gynecology [OBGYN], family medicine and pediatrics) residency preparation course (RPC) in 2020-2021 participated. Students received 3-6 specialty-specific pages that represented an urgent change in clinical status about a simulated patient. For each page, students first called a standardized registered nurse (SRN) to ask additional questions, then recommended next steps in evaluation and management. The SRNs delivered immediate verbal feedback, delayed written feedback, and graded clinical performance using a weighted rubric. Some items were categorized as 'must do,' which represented the most clinically important actions. Trends in clinical performance over time were analyzed using the Jonckheere-Terpstra test. Of the 315 eligible students, 265 (84.1%) consented for their data to be included in the analysis. Clinical performance improved from a median (interquartile range) of 59.4% (46.9%, 75.0%) on case 1 to 80.0% (68.0%, 86.7%) on case 6 (p < .001). The percentage of 'must do' items improved significantly, from 69.2% (53.8, 81.8%) to 80.0% (66.7%, 88,9%) (p < .001). Scores improved over time for all specialty courses except for EM and OB/GYN. Surveyed students largely found this to be a valuable addition to the RPC curriculum with a 4.4 overall rating (1 = poor to 5 = excellent). This novel curriculum fills important gaps in the educational transition between medical school and residency. The simulated paging platform is adaptable and generalizable to learners entering different residency specialties.

Romanova A, Touchie C, Ruller S, Kaka S, Moschella A, Zucker M, Cole V, Humphrey-Murto S. Learning Plan Use in Undergraduate Medical Education: A Scoping Review. 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2024; 99:1038-1045. [PMID: 38905130 DOI: 10.1097/acm.0000000000005781]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 06/23/2024]
Abstract
PURPOSE How to best support self-regulated learning (SRL) skills development and track trainees' progress along their competency-based medical education learning trajectory is unclear. Learning plans (LPs) may be the answer; however, information on their use in undergraduate medical education (UME) is limited. This study summarizes the literature regarding LP use in UME, explores the student's role in LP development and implementation, and identifies additional research areas. METHOD MEDLINE, Embase, PsycInfo, Education Source, and Web of Science databases were searched for articles published from database inception to March 6, 2024, and relevant reference lists were manually searched. The review included studies of undergraduate medical students, studies of LP use, and studies of the UME stage in any geographic setting. Data were analyzed using quantitative and qualitative content analyses. RESULTS The database search found 7,871 titles and abstracts with an additional 25 found from the manual search for a total of 7,896 articles, of which 39 met inclusion criteria. Many LPs lacked a guiding framework. LPs were associated with self-reported improved SRL skill development, learning structure, and learning outcomes. Barriers to their use for students and faculty were time to create and implement LPs, lack of training on LP development and implementation, and lack of engagement. Facilitators included SRL skill development, LP cocreation, and guidance by a trained mentor. Identified research gaps include objective outcome measures, longitudinal impact beyond UME, standardized framework for LP development and quality assessment, and training on SRL skills and LPs. CONCLUSIONS This review demonstrates variability of LP use in UME. LPs appear to have potential to support medical student education and facilitate translation of SRL skills into residency training. Successful use requires training and an experienced mentor. However, more research is required to determine whether benefits of LPs outweigh the resources required for their use.

Caretta-Weyer HA, Park YS, Tekian A, Sebok-Syer SS. The Inconspicuous Learner Handover: An Exploratory Study of U.S. Emergency Medicine Program Directors' Perceptions of Learner Handovers from Medical School to Residency. TEACHING AND LEARNING IN MEDICINE 2024; 36:134-142. [PMID: 36794363 DOI: 10.1080/10401334.2023.2178438]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 04/14/2022] [Revised: 01/13/2023] [Accepted: 01/31/2023] [Indexed: 06/18/2023]
Abstract
Phenomenon: Central to competency-based medical education is the need for a seamless developmental continuum of training and practice. Trainees currently experience significant discontinuity in the transition from undergraduate (UME) to graduate medical education (GME). The learner handover is intended to smooth this transition, but little is known about how well this is working from the GME perspective. In an attempt to gather preliminary evidence, this study explores U.S. program directors (PDs) perspective of the learner handover from UME to GME. Approach: Using exploratory qualitative methodology, we conducted semi-structured interviews with 12 Emergency Medicine PDs within the U.S. from October to November, 2020. We asked participants to describe their current perception of the learner handover from UME to GME. Then we performed thematic analysis using an inductive approach. Findings: We identified two main themes: The inconspicuous learner handover and barrier to creating a successful UME to GME learner handover. PDs described the current state of the learner handover as "nonexistent," yet acknowledged that information is transmitted from UME to GME. Participants also highlighted key challenges preventing a successful learner handover from UME to GME. These included: conflicting expectations, issues of trust and transparency, and a dearth of assessment data to actually hand over. Insights: PDs highlight the inconspicuous nature of learner handovers, suggesting that assessment information is not shared in the way it should be in the transition from UME to GME. Challenges with the learner handover demonstrate a lack of trust, transparency, and explicit communication between UME and GME. Our findings can inform how national organizations establish a unified approach to transmitting growth-oriented assessment data and formalize transparent learner handovers from UME to GME.

Conway C, McKeague H, Harney S. The missing ingredient: Medical student insights to inform and enhance learner handover. CLINICAL TEACHER 2024; 21:e13659. [PMID: 37766481 DOI: 10.1111/tct.13659]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/24/2023] [Accepted: 08/26/2023] [Indexed: 09/29/2023]
Abstract
BACKGROUND Learner handover (LH) is the passing on of information about students between educators. In light of broad acceptance that LH can improve learner support experiences and performance outcomes, those involved are seeking greater governance to achieve practical, effective handover implementation. Stakeholder consultation can inform and enable the co-creation of meaningful, robust practice guidance. This study sought to address the gap in literature around in-depth learner opinion, a key element so far overlooked. METHODS This qualitative study (2022) investigated undergraduate medical student perspectives on appropriate tutor information-sharing at the University of Limerick School of Medicine (ULSoM). The findings build upon an educator focus group study published by the authors (2021). Eleven participants were recruited to represent the typical graduate-entry medical school programme population across years 1-4 of study. Their understanding and expectations of "learner handover" were explored qualitatively, using online, individual, semi-structured interviews. Inductive transcript coding and thematic data analysis were applied to illustrate learner insights. FINDINGS Emergent themes included shared values, individual context and collaborative process, with ideas proposed for specific action around student education, staff training, mental health support, and documented procedures. DISCUSSION Consent, system transparency, data security and the development of positive handover culture were revealed as current needs. Student perspectives, together existing LH literature and highlighted aspects of educational theory, allowed the creation a new conceptual LH framework as a foundation for practice improvement. CONCLUSION These findings provide clarity and contextual understanding, mainly from a pre-clinical phase learner standpoint, with pragmatic suggestions to enhance LH appeal.

Heidemann LA, Rustici M, Buckvar-Keltz L, Anderson A, Plant J, Morgan HK, Goforth J, Atkins KM. Transition to Residency Courses: Recommendations for Creation and Implementation. JOURNAL OF MEDICAL EDUCATION AND CURRICULAR DEVELOPMENT 2024; 11:23821205231225009. [PMID: 38304278 PMCID: PMC10832425 DOI: 10.1177/23821205231225009]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Received: 09/16/2023] [Accepted: 12/19/2023] [Indexed: 02/03/2024]
Abstract
Transition to Residency (TTR) courses help ease the critical transition from medical school to residency, yet there is little guidance for developing and running these courses. In this perspective, the authors use their expertise as well as a review of the literature to provide guidance and review possible solutions to challenges unique to these courses. TTR courses should be specialty-specific, allow for flexibility, and utilize active learning techniques. A needs assessment can help guide course content, which should focus on what is necessary to be ready for day one of residency. The use of residents in course planning and delivery can help create a sense of community and ensure that content is practical. While course assessments are largely formative, instructors should anticipate the need for remediation, especially for skills likely to be performed with limited supervision during residency. Additionally, TTR courses should incorporate learner self-assessment and goal setting; this may be valuable information to share with learners' future residency programs. Lastly, TTR courses should undergo continuous quality improvement based on course evaluations and surveys. These recommendations are essential for effective TTR course implementation and improvement.

Zetkulic M, Moriarty JP, Amin A, Angus S, Dalal B, Fazio S, Hemmer P, Laird-Fick HS, Muchmore E, Nixon LJ, Olson A, Choe JH. Exploring Competency-Based Medical Education Through the Lens of the UME-GME Transition: A Qualitative Study. 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2024; 99:83-90. [PMID: 37699535 PMCID: PMC11809725 DOI: 10.1097/acm.0000000000005449]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 09/14/2023]
Abstract
PURPOSE Competency-based medical education (CBME) represents a shift to a paradigm with shared definitions, explicit outcomes, and assessments of competence. The groundwork has been laid to ensure all learners achieve the desired outcomes along the medical education continuum using the principles of CBME. However, this continuum spans the major transition from undergraduate medical education (UME) to graduate medical education (GME) that is also evolving. This study explores the experiences of medical educators working to use CBME assessments in the context of the UME-GME transition and their perspectives on the existing challenges. METHOD This study used a constructivist-oriented qualitative methodology. In-depth, semistructured interviews of UME and GME leaders in CBME were performed between February 2019 and January 2020 via Zoom. When possible, each interviewee was interviewed by 2 team members, one with UME and one with GME experience, which allowed follow-up questions to be pursued that reflected the perspectives of both UME and GME educators more fully. A multistep iterative process of thematic analysis was used to analyze the transcripts and identify patterns across interviews. RESULTS The 9 interviewees represented a broad swath of UME and GME leadership positions, though most had an internal medicine training background. Analysis identified 4 overarching themes: mistrust (a trust chasm exists between UME and GME); misaligned goals (the residency selection process is antithetical to CBME); inadequate communication (communication regarding competence is infrequent, often unidirectional, and lacks a shared language); and inflexible timeframes (current training timeframes do not account for individual learners' competency trajectories). CONCLUSIONS Despite the mutual desire and commitment to move to CBME across the continuum, mistrust, misaligned goals, inadequate communication, and inflexible timeframes confound such efforts of individual schools and programs. If current efforts to improve the UME-GME transition address the themes identified, educators may be more successful implementing CBME along the continuum.

Schoppen Z, Morgan HK, Hammoud M, Marzano D, George K, Winkel AF. Applicant Experience in Communication With Residency Programs After the Introduction of Program Signaling. JOURNAL OF SURGICAL EDUCATION 2023; 80:1762-1772. [PMID: 37633809 DOI: 10.1016/j.jsurg.2023.08.005]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 06/26/2023] [Revised: 07/29/2023] [Accepted: 08/01/2023] [Indexed: 08/28/2023]
Abstract
OBJECTIVE Examine the applicant experience after introduction of program signaling for the 2023 obstetrics and gynecology (OBGYN) residency application cycle. DESIGN Responses to an online survey of OBGYN applicants participating in the 2023 match who participated in residency program signaling were compared to responses from a similar survey conducted in 2022. Demographic information included personal and academic background and how applicants and advisors communicated with programs. Numbers of applications and interviews, second look visits, away rotations, manner of contact, and timing of communication was compared. Statistical analysis included ANOVA for interval data, and χ2 and Kruskal-Wallis tests for categorical data. RESULTS A total of 711 of 2631 (27%) applicants responded in 2022 and 606 of 2492 (24.3%) responded in 2023. Approximately 2/3 of gold signals and 1/3 of silver signals led to an interview. There was no change in number of applications or interviews per applicant, but there was a broader distribution of interviews per applicant in 2023. Applicants in 2023 were less likely to engage in preinterview communication or do an away rotation to indicate interest in a program. There was decreased communication between applicants and programs after signaling was introduced. Informal communication continued to differ by racial and medical school background. Applicants from DO programs and international medical graduates (IMG) had more communication with programs than MD applicants but received fewer interview invitations. Fewer Black and Latin(x)/Hispanic applicants had faculty reach out to residency programs on their behalf compared to White and Asian applicants. There were differences in the number of interviews received based on racial and ethnic identity. CONCLUSIONS In the first year after implementation of program signaling, there was a decrease in preinterview communication and a broader distribution of interviews among applicants. Further efforts to create standard means of program communication may help to begin leveling the uneven playing field for applicants.

Shaw T, LaDonna KA, Hauer KE, Khalife R, Sheu L, Wood TJ, Montgomery A, Rauscher S, Aggarwal S, Humphrey-Murto S. Having a Bad Day Is Not an Option: Learner Perspectives on Learner Handover. 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2023; 98:S58-S64. [PMID: 37983397 DOI: 10.1097/acm.0000000000005433]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 08/12/2023]
Abstract
PURPOSE Learner handover is the sharing of learner-related information between supervisors involved in their education. The practice allows learners to build upon previous assessments and can support the growth-oriented focus of competency-based medical education. However, learner handover also carries the risk of biasing future assessments and breaching learner confidentiality. Little is known about learner handover's educational impact, and what is known is largely informed by faculty and institutional perspectives. The purpose of this study was to explore learner handover from the learner perspective. METHOD Constructivist grounded theory was used to explore learners' perspectives and beliefs around learner handover. Twenty-nine semistructured interviews were completed with medical students and residents from the University of Ottawa and University of California, San Francisco. Interviews took place between April and December 2020. Using the constant comparative approach, themes were identified through an iterative process. RESULTS Learners were generally unaware of specific learner handover practices, although most recognized circumstances where both formal and informal handovers may occur. Learners appreciated the potential for learner handover to tailor education, guide entrustment and supervision decisions, and support patient safety, but worried about its potential to bias future assessments and breach confidentiality. Furthermore, learners were concerned that information-sharing may be more akin to gossip rather than focused on their educational needs and feared unfair scrutiny and irreversible long-term career consequences from one shared mediocre performance. Altogether, these concerns fueled an overwhelming pressure to perform. CONCLUSIONS While learners recognized the rationale for learner handover, they feared the possible inadvertent short- and long-term impact on their training and future careers. Designing policies that support transparency and build awareness around learner handover may mitigate unintended consequences that can threaten learning and the learner-supervisor relationship, ensuring learner handover benefits the learner as intended.

Klig JE, Kettyle WM, Kosowsky JM, Phillips, Jr. WR, Farrell SE, Hundert EM, Dalrymple JL, Goldhamer MEJ. A pilot clinical skills coaching program to reimagine remediation: a cohort study. MEDEDPUBLISH 2023; 13:29. [PMID: 37674590 PMCID: PMC10477753 DOI: 10.12688/mep.19621.2]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 09/08/2023] Open
Abstract
Background New approaches are needed to improve and destigmatize remediation in undergraduate medical education (UME). The COVID-19 pandemic magnified the need to support struggling learners to ensure competency and readiness for graduate medical education (GME). Clinical skills (CS) coaching is an underutilized approach that may mitigate the stigma of remedial learning. Methods A six-month CS coaching pilot was conducted at Harvard Medical School (HMS) as a destigmatized remedial learning environment for clerkship and post-clerkship students identified as 'at risk' based on objective structured clinical examinations (OSCE). The pilot entailed individual and group coaching with five faculty, direct bedside observation of CS, and standardized patient encounters with video review. Strengths-based coaching principles and appreciative inquiry were emphasized. Results Twenty-three students participated in the pilot: 14 clerkship students (cohort 1) and 9 post-clerkship students (cohort 2). All clerkship students (cohort 1) demonstrated sustained improvement in CS across three OSCEs compared to baseline: at pilot close, at 6-months post pilot, and at 21-24 months post-pilot all currently graduating students (10/10, 100%) passed the summative OSCE, an HMS graduation requirement. All post-clerkship students (cohort 2) passed the HMS graduation OSCE (9/9,100%). Feedback survey results included clerkship students (9/14; 64%) and post-clerkship students (7/9; 78%); all respondents unanimously agreed that individual coaching was "impactful to my clinical learning and practice". Faculty and leadership fully supported the pilot as a destigmatized and effective approach to remediation. Conclusion Remediation has an essential and growing role in medical schools. CS coaching for remedial learning can reduce stigma, foster a growth mindset, and support sustained progress for 'at risk' early clerkship through final year students. An "implementation template" with suggested tools and timelines can be locally adapted to guide CS coaching for UME remediation. The CS coaching pilot model is feasible and can be generalized to many UME programs.

Triola MM, Burk-Rafel J. Precision Medical Education. 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2023; 98:775-781. [PMID: 37027222 DOI: 10.1097/acm.0000000000005227] [Citation(s) in RCA: 24] [Impact Index Per Article: 12.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 06/19/2023]
Abstract
Medical schools and residency programs are increasingly incorporating personalization of content, pathways, and assessments to align with a competency-based model. Yet, such efforts face challenges involving large amounts of data, sometimes struggling to deliver insights in a timely fashion for trainees, coaches, and programs. In this article, the authors argue that the emerging paradigm of precision medical education (PME) may ameliorate some of these challenges. However, PME lacks a widely accepted definition and a shared model of guiding principles and capacities, limiting widespread adoption. The authors propose defining PME as a systematic approach that integrates longitudinal data and analytics to drive precise educational interventions that address each individual learner's needs and goals in a continuous, timely, and cyclical fashion, ultimately improving meaningful educational, clinical, or system outcomes. Borrowing from precision medicine, they offer an adapted shared framework. In the P4 medical education framework, PME should (1) take a proactive approach to acquiring and using trainee data; (2) generate timely personalized insights through precision analytics (including artificial intelligence and decision-support tools); (3) design precision educational interventions (learning, assessment, coaching, pathways) in a participatory fashion, with trainees at the center as co-producers; and (4) ensure interventions are predictive of meaningful educational, professional, or clinical outcomes. Implementing PME will require new foundational capacities: flexible educational pathways and programs responsive to PME-guided dynamic and competency-based progression; comprehensive longitudinal data on trainees linked to educational and clinical outcomes; shared development of requisite technologies and analytics to effect educational decision-making; and a culture that embraces a precision approach, with research to gather validity evidence for this approach and development efforts targeting new skills needed by learners, coaches, and educational leaders. Anticipating pitfalls in the use of this approach will be important, as will ensuring it deepens, rather than replaces, the interaction of trainees and their coaches.

Fowler MJ, Crook TW, Russell RG, Cutrer WB. Master clinical teachers and personalised learning. CLINICAL TEACHER 2023; 20:e13562. [PMID: 36760070 DOI: 10.1111/tct.13562]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/08/2022] [Accepted: 01/06/2023] [Indexed: 02/11/2023]
Abstract
Clinical history taking and physical examination are two of the most important competencies of physicians. In addition to informing diagnoses, these activities build rapport and establish relationships between caregivers and patients. Despite this, emphasis on the assessment of bedside clinical skills is declining. To prepare our students for clinical work, we began a clinical competency, personalised teaching programme in which students perform a history and physical examination in front of a master clinical teacher (MCT) approximately every 2 weeks throughout their core clerkship year. The MCT works with the student in a clinical encounter, providing personalised bedside instruction on all features of being a clinician including bedside manner, history-taking skills, physical examination skills, and clinical reasoning. The MCT then provides an assessment of student's competency development and gives feedback to the student about what they do well and where they have opportunities for growth. Assessment data are collected and tracked longitudinally across the clerkship phase to ensure that each student is progressing developmentally. With over 6000 observations of student performance, we are able to discern competency development and growth over time. We can identify if a student is not improving as expected during their clerkship phase and intervene by providing extra practice and training. This core clerkship teaching programme has been well received by both students and instructors and has led us to pilot this approach during the post-clerkship phase of our medical training.

Hauer KE, Williams PM, Byerley JS, Swails JL, Barone MA. Blue Skies With Clouds: Envisioning the Future Ideal State and Identifying Ongoing Tensions in the UME-GME Transition. 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2023; 98:162-170. [PMID: 35947473 DOI: 10.1097/acm.0000000000004920]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 06/15/2023]
Abstract
The transition from medical school to residency in the United States consumes large amounts of time for students and educators in undergraduate and graduate medical education (UME, GME), and it is costly for both students and institutions. Attempts to improve the residency application and Match processes have been insufficient to counteract the very large number of applications to programs. To address these challenges, the Coalition for Physician Accountability charged the Undergraduate Medical Education to Graduate Medical Education Review Committee (UGRC) with crafting recommendations to improve the system for the UME-GME transition. To guide this work, the UGRC defined and sought stakeholder input on a "blue-skies" ideal state of this transition. The ideal state views the transition as a system to support a continuum of professional development and learning, thus serving learners, educators, and the public, and engendering trust among them. It also supports the well-being of learners and educators, promotes diversity, and minimizes bias. This manuscript uses polarity thinking to analyze 3 persistent key tensions in the system that require ongoing management. First, the formative purpose of assessment for learning and growth is at odds with the use of assessment data for ranking and sorting candidates. Second, the function of residents as learners can conflict with their role as workers contributing service to health care systems. Third, the current residency Match process can position the desire for individual choice-among students and their programs-against the workforce needs of the profession and the public. This Scholarly Perspective presents strategies to balance the upsides and downsides inherent to these tensions. By articulating the ideal state of the UME-GME transition and anticipating tensions, educators and educational organizations can be better positioned to implement UGRC recommendations to improve the transition system.

Carraccio C, Lentz A, Schumacher DJ. "Dismantling Fixed Time, Variable Outcome Education: Abandoning 'Ready or Not, Here they Come' is Overdue". PERSPECTIVES ON MEDICAL EDUCATION 2023; 12:68-75. [PMID: 36937800 PMCID: PMC10022540 DOI: 10.5334/pme.10]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 10/12/2022] [Accepted: 02/28/2023] [Indexed: 05/05/2023]
Abstract
Two decades after competency-based medical education appeared in the lexicon of medical educators, the community continues to struggle with realizing its full potential. The implementation of the time variable, fixed outcome component has languished based on complexity compounded by resistance to change. Learners continue to transition from medical school to residency, and then practice, primarily based on time rather than having achieved the ability to meet the needs of the patient populations they will serve. Only those few who demonstrate glaring deficiencies do not graduate. The authors urge the medical education community to move from the current fixed time path of medical education toward the implementation of a true continuum of time variable, fixed outcome education, training, and deliberate practice. The latter is defined by purposeful learning, coaching, feedback, and repetition on the path to achieving and maintaining expertise. The opportunities afforded by such a time-variable, fixed outcome approach include: 1) development of a career long growth mindset, 2) ability to address evolving population health needs and careers within the context of one's practice, and 3) continual improvement of care quality and outcomes for patients on the journey towards expertise for providers.

Warm EJ, Kinnear B, Lance S, Schauer DP, Brenner J. What Behaviors Define a Good Physician? Assessing and Communicating About Noncognitive Skills. 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2022; 97:193-199. [PMID: 34166233 DOI: 10.1097/acm.0000000000004215] [Citation(s) in RCA: 11] [Impact Index Per Article: 3.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 06/13/2023]
Abstract
Once medical students attain a certain level of medical knowledge, success in residency often depends on noncognitive attributes, such as conscientiousness, empathy, and grit. These traits are significantly more difficult to assess than cognitive performance, creating a potential gap in measurement. Despite its promise, competency-based medical education (CBME) has yet to bridge this gap, partly due to a lack of well-defined noncognitive observable behaviors that assessors and educators can use in formative and summative assessment. As a result, typical undergraduate to graduate medical education handovers stress standardized test scores, and program directors trust little of the remaining information they receive, sometimes turning to third-party companies to better describe potential residency candidates. The authors have created a list of noncognitive attributes, with associated definitions and noncognitive skills-called observable practice activities (OPAs)-written for learners across the continuum to help educators collect assessment data that can be turned into valuable information. OPAs are discrete work-based assessment elements collected over time and mapped to larger structures, such as milestones, entrustable professional activities, or competencies, to create learning trajectories for formative and summative decisions. Medical schools and graduate medical education programs could adapt these OPAs or determine ways to create new ones specific to their own contexts. Once OPAs are created, programs will have to find effective ways to assess them, interpret the data, determine consequence validity, and communicate information to learners and institutions. The authors discuss the need for culture change surrounding assessment-even for the adoption of behavior-based tools such as OPAs-including grounding the work in a growth mindset and the broad underpinnings of CBME. Ultimately, improving assessment of noncognitive capacity should benefit learners, schools, programs, and most importantly, patients.

Schwartz A, Borman-Shoap E, Carraccio C, Herman B, Hobday PM, Kaul P, Long M, O'Connor M, Mink R, Schumacher DJ, Turner DA, West DC. Learner Levels of Supervision Across the Continuum of Pediatrics Training. 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2021; 96:S42-S49. [PMID: 34183601 DOI: 10.1097/acm.0000000000004095]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 06/13/2023]
Abstract
PURPOSE To describe trajectories in level of supervision ratings for linked entrustable professional activities (EPAs) among pediatric learners in medical school, residency, fellowship. METHOD The authors performed secondary analyses of 3 linked datasets of level of supervision ratings for the Core EPAs for Entering Residency, the General Pediatrics EPAs, and the Subspecialty Pediatrics EPAs. After identifying 9 activities in common across training stages and aligning the level of entrustment-supervision scales across the datasets, piecewise ordinal and linear mixed effects models were fitted to characterize trajectories of supervision ratings. RESULTS Within each training period, learners were rated as needing less supervision over time in each activity. When transitioning from medical school to residency or during the first year of residency, learners were rated as needing greater supervision in activities related to patient management, teamwork, emergent care, and public health/QI than in earlier periods. When transitioning from residency to fellowship, learners were always rated as needing greater supervision than they had been accorded at the end of residency and sometimes even more than they had been accorded at the start of residency. CONCLUSIONS Although development over training is often imagined as continuous and monotonically increasing competence, this study provides empirical evidence supporting the idea that entrustment is a set of discrete decisions. The relaxation of supervision in training is not a linear process. Even with a seamless curriculum, supervision is tightly bound to the training setting. Several explanations for these findings are discussed.

Beck Dallaghan GL, Alexandraki I, Christner J, Keeley M, Khandelwal S, Steiner B, Hemmer PA. Medical School to Residency: How Can We Trust the Process? Cureus 2021; 13:e14485. [PMID: 34007741 PMCID: PMC8121123 DOI: 10.7759/cureus.14485]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/07/2022] Open
Abstract
Background To say that the transition from undergraduate medical education (UME) to graduate medical education (GME) is under scrutiny would be an understatement. Findings from a panel discussion at the 2018 Association of American Medical Colleges Annual meeting entitled, “Pass-Fail in Medical School and the Residency Application Process and Graduate Medical Education Transition” addressed what and when information should be shared with residency programs, and how and when that information should be shared. Materials and Methods Over 250 participants representing UME and GME (e.g. leadership, faculty, medical students) completed worksheets addressing these questions. During report-back times, verbal comments were transcribed in real time, and written comments on worksheets were later transcribed. All comments were anonymous. Thematic analysis was conducted manually by the research team to analyze the worksheet responses and report back comments. Results Themes based on suggestions of what information should be shared included the following: 1) developmental/assessment benchmarks such as demonstrating the ability/competencies to do clinical work; 2) performance on examinations; 3) grades and class ranking; 4) 360 evaluations; 5) narrative evaluations; 6) failures/remediation/gaps in training; 7) professionalism lapses; 8) characteristics of students such as resiliency/reliability; and 9) service/leadership/participation. In terms of how this information should be shared, the participants suggested enhancements to the current process of transmitting documents rather than alternative methods (e.g., video, telephonic, face-to-face discussions) and information sharing at both the time of the match and again near/at graduation to include information about post-match rotations. Discussion Considerations to address concerns with the transition from medical school to residency include further enhancements to the Medical Student Performance Evaluation, viewing departmental letters as ones of evaluation and not recommendation, a more meaningful educational handoff, and limits on the number of residency applications allowed for each student. The current medical education environment is ready for meaningful change in the UME to GME transition.

Humphrey-Murto S, Lingard L, Varpio L, Watling CJ, Ginsburg S, Rauscher S, LaDonna K. Learner Handover: Who Is It Really For? ACADEMIC MEDICINE : JOURNAL OF THE ASSOCIATION OF AMERICAN MEDICAL COLLEGES 2021; 96:592-598. [PMID: 33177320 DOI: 10.1097/acm.0000000000003842] [Citation(s) in RCA: 12]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 06/11/2023]
Abstract
PURPOSE Learner handover is the sharing of information about learners between faculty supervisors. Learner handover can support longitudinal assessment in rotation-based systems, but there are concerns that the practice could bias future assessments or stigmatize struggling learners. Because successful implementation relies on an understanding of existing practices and beliefs, the purpose of this study was to explore how faculty perceive and enact learner handover in the workplace. METHOD Using constructivist grounded theory, 23 semistructured interviews were conducted with faculty from 2 Canadian universities between August and December 2018. Participants were asked to describe their learner handover practices, including learner handover delivered or received about resident and student trainees either within or between clinical rotations. The authors probed to understand why faculty used learner handover and their perceptions of its benefits and risks. RESULTS Learner handover occurs both formally and informally and serves multiple purposes for learners and faculty. While participants reported that learner handover was motivated by both learner benefit and patient safety, they primarily described motivations focused on their own needs. Learner handover was used to improve faculty efficiency by focusing teaching and feedback and was perceived as a "self-defense mechanism" when faculty were uncertain about a learner's competence and trustworthiness. Informal learner handover also served social or therapeutic purposes when faculty used these conversations to gossip, vent, or manage insecurities about their assessment of learner performance. Because of its multiple, sometimes unsanctioned purposes, participants recommended being reflective about motivations behind learner handover conversations. CONCLUSIONS Learners are not the only potential beneficiaries of learner handover; faculty use learner handover to lessen insecurities surrounding entrustment and assessment of learners and to openly share their frustrations. The latter created tensions for faculty needing to share stresses but wanting to act professionally. Formal education policies regarding learner handover should consider faculty perspectives.

Heidemann LA, Schiller JH, Allen B, Hughes DT, Fitzgerald JT, Morgan HK. Student Perceptions of educational handovers. CLINICAL TEACHER 2021; 18:280-284. [PMID: 33465836 DOI: 10.1111/tct.13327] [Citation(s) in RCA: 4]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/07/2020] [Revised: 12/03/2020] [Accepted: 12/07/2020] [Indexed: 11/27/2022]
Abstract
BACKGROUND Educational handovers can provide competency information about graduating medical students to residency program directors post-residency placement. Little is known about students' comfort with this novel communication. OBJECTIVE To examine graduated medical students' perceptions of educational handovers. METHODS The authors created and distributed an anonymous survey to 166 medical students at a single institution following graduation in the spring of 2018. Within this cohort, 40 students had an educational handover sent to their future program director. The survey explored comfort level with handovers (1=very uncomfortable; 5=very comfortable) and ideal content (e.g., student strengths, areas for improvement, goals, grades received after residency application). Respondents self-reported their performance in medical school and whether a handover was sent. Correlation analyses examined relationships between performance and other variables. T-tests examined differences between students who did and did not have a handover letter sent. RESULTS The survey response rate was 40.4% (67/166) - 47.8% of students felt comfortable with handovers, 19.4% were neutral, and 32.8% were uncomfortable. There was no correlation between self-reported medical school performance and comfort level. Respondents felt most strongly that strengths should be included, followed by goals. Those who had a handover letter sent expressed significantly higher comfort level (3.8 ± 1.0 vs. 2.6 ±1.3, p=0.003) with this communication. CONCLUSION Medical students reported varying levels of comfort with educational handovers; however, those who had handovers sent had more positive perceptions. In order to improve the education continuum, it is essential to engage students in the development of this handover communication.

Kassam A, Nickell L, Pethrick H, Mountjoy M, Topps M, Lorenzetti DL. Facilitating Learner-Centered Transition to Residency: A Scoping Review of Programs Aimed at Intrinsic Competencies. TEACHING AND LEARNING IN MEDICINE 2021; 33:10-20. [PMID: 32945704 DOI: 10.1080/10401334.2020.1789466]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 06/11/2023]
Abstract
Phenomenon: There is currently a move to provide residency programs with accurate competency-based assessments of their candidates, yet there is a gap in knowledge regarding the role and effectiveness of interventions in easing the transition to residency. The impact of key stakeholder engagement, learner-centeredness, intrinsic competencies, and assessment on the efficacy of this process has not been examined. The objective of this scoping review was to explore the nature of the existing scholarship on programs that aim to facilitate the transition from medical school to residency. Approach: We searched MEDLINE and EMBASE from inception to April 2020. Programs were included if they were aimed at medical students completing undergraduate medical training or first year residents and an evaluative component. Two authors independently screened all abstracts and full text articles in duplicate. Data were extracted and categorized by type of program, study design, learner-centeredness, key stakeholder engagement, the extent of information sharing about the learner to facilitate the transition to residency, and specific program elements including participants, and program outcomes. We also extracted data on intrinsic (non-Medical Expert) competencies, as defined by the CanMEDS competency framework. Findings: Of the 1,006 studies identified, 55 met the criteria for inclusion in this review. The majority of the articles that were eligible for inclusion were from the United States (n = 31, 57%). Most of the studies (n = 47, 85%) employed quantitative, or mixed method research designs. Positive outcomes that were commonly reported included increased self-confidence, competence in being prepared for residency, and satisfaction with the transition program. While a variety of learner-centered programs that focus on specific intrinsic competencies have been implemented, many (n = 29, 52%) did not report engaging learners as key stakeholders in program development. Insights: While programs that aim to ease the transition from medical school to residency can enhance both Medical Expert and other intrinsic competencies, there is much room for novel transition programs to define their goals more broadly and to incorporate multiple areas of professional development. The existing literature highlights various gaps in approaches to easing the transition from medical school to residency, particularly with respect to key stakeholder engagement, addressing intrinsic CanMEDS competencies, and focusing on individual learners' needs.
